Title: The Innovative Contributions of Krystyna Skupinska
Introduction
Krystyna Skupinska is a notable inventor based in New Westminster, Canada. She has made significant contributions to the field of chemistry, particularly in the development of compounds that interact with chemokine receptors. With a total of 3 patents to her name, her work has implications for treating various medical conditions.
Latest Patents
One of her latest patents is focused on CXCR4 chemokine receptor binding compounds. This invention relates to compounds that bind to chemokine receptors and includes methods for treating HIV infection and inflammatory conditions such as rheumatoid arthritis. Additionally, it outlines methods to elevate progenitor and stem cell counts, as well as white blood cell counts using these compounds. Another significant patent involves chemokine receptor binding heterocyclic compounds with enhanced efficacy. These compounds are designed to interact with the CXCR4 receptor and are useful in treating HIV infection, inflammatory conditions, asthma, and cancer.
